Output 45320b73ec65b9a84f8c630ecd69336d82911e3481b45eda0a838b4d5de2fe78:0

value
15618
script pubkey
OP_0 OP_PUSHBYTES_20 dbb8f58b77e8240c91a2294850c67502166678eb
address
bc1qmwu0tzmhaqjqeydz99y9p3n4qgtxv78trvgesc
transaction
45320b73ec65b9a84f8c630ecd69336d82911e3481b45eda0a838b4d5de2fe78
confirmations
136044
spent
true